Understanding the Swedish Driving License System


The Swedish Transport Administration, referred to as Transportstyrelsen, manages the issuance and policy of driving licenses throughout Sweden. Unlike some nations where the procedure may be relatively fast and straightforward, Sweden has actually developed a strenuous system created to ensure that every licensed chauffeur has not just the technical skills to operate a lorry but also a deep understanding of traffic rules, threat awareness, and accountable driving habits. This technique has actually contributed considerably to Sweden's exceptionally low traffic fatality rates compared to numerous other countries.

A Swedish driving license functions as both a legal requirement for driving and an official identity document. The license itself is a plastic card, similar to a credit card in size and durability, containing the holder's photograph, individual details, and the categories of cars they are permitted to drive. The most common classification for passenger vehicles is B, which covers cars and light trucks.

The Step-by-Step Process


The journey toward obtaining a Swedish driving license begins with enrolling at a licensed driving school, though individuals are not legally needed to utilize expert guideline for all parts of the process. The first major turning point includes finishing theoretical education, that includes coursework in traffic policies, lorry mechanics, ecological factors to consider, and danger perception. This theoretical structure is absolutely necessary, as it forms the basis for safe driving practices that will be tested throughout the licensing procedure.

After finishing the compulsory coursework, prospects must pass a theoretical assessment, typically called the kunskapsprov. This test evaluates the individual's understanding of Swedish traffic laws, road indications, and various driving scenarios. The assessment is designed to examine not just memorization but likewise the capability to apply understanding in practical situations. Numerous prospects find that extensive preparation through research study materials and practice tests considerably enhances their possibilities of success on the very first attempt.

Following successful completion of the theoretical examination, the focus moves to useful driving training. This element needs prospects to develop proficiency in car control, maneuverability, and safe interaction with other roadway users. The useful training normally includes a specific variety of compulsory lessons covering various proficiencies, though the total amount of training needed varies based upon the individual's previous experience and natural ability. Training frequently encompasses night driving, highway driving, and driving in tough conditions such as rain or snow, which are common in Sweden.

The last hurdle in the licensing procedure is the uppkörning, or practical driving test. This test assesses the prospect's capability to operate an automobile securely in real traffic conditions. An examiner from Transportstyrelsen observes the prospect's performance, evaluating whatever from fundamental lorry control to intricate decision-making in traffic. The test typically lasts in between 30 and 45 minutes and consists of different driving scenarios that the prospect must browse successfully.

Beyond the monetary requirements, prospects should fulfill several eligibility requirements. People must be at least 16 years of age for a moped license and 18 years for a basic vehicle license. Candidates must hold a valid identification document, generally a Swedish individuality number. Additionally, candidates must have finished the compulsory threat education courses, which deal with topics such as the results of alcohol and drugs on driving, fatigue, and the value of utilizing safety restraints.

Converting a Foreign License in Sweden


For individuals who already hold a valid driving license from another country, Sweden provides different arrangements depending on the country of origin. Licenses from European Union member states and the European Economic Area countries can typically be exchanged for a Swedish license without requiring additional screening, provided the original license stays legitimate. This mutual plan streamlines the procedure for numerous new residents relocating from other European countries.

Licenses from countries outside the EU/EEA need more involved treatments. Depending upon the particular nation and the contracts in location between Sweden which nation, individuals may need to pass either the theoretical assessment, the practical driving test, or both. Some countries have developed exchange agreements that minimize or remove screening requirements, while others demand complete re-examination. The Transportstyrelsen website offers in-depth info particular to each nation's plan.

It is crucial to note that utilizing a foreign license in Sweden usually has time constraints for non-EU/EEA people. New citizens must check their particular situation to ensure they remain legal chauffeurs throughout their time in Sweden. Running an automobile with an ended or void foreign license can lead to significant legal repercussions.

Types of Swedish Driving Licenses


Sweden issues a number of classifications of driving licenses, each licensing the holder to operate different types of automobiles. Comprehending these classifications assists people pursue the suitable license for their requirements.

The Category B license stays the most commonly sought, licensing the driving of automobile and light delivery lorries with a maximum authorized mass of 3,500 kgs. This license allows pulling trailers under particular conditions and serves as the standard requirement for a lot of personal vehicle operation. Lots of drivers find that the B license adequately fulfills their transport needs for everyday travelling, household travel, and basic mobility.

For those thinking about running motorcycles, Sweden uses graduated licensing through Categories A1, A2, and A. Each classification corresponds to various engine sizes and power outputs, with progressive age and experience requirements. This finished method makes sure that riders establish proper skills before accessing more effective motorcycles.

Business driving licenses fall under Categories C and D, covering big trucks and passenger buses respectively. These licenses require additional training and screening, reflecting the increased duty associated with operating automobiles designed for expert transport functions.

Typical Questions About Swedish Driving Licenses


How long does the entire procedure generally take?

The duration differs significantly based upon specific commitment and scheduling schedule. For extremely motivated candidates who progress quickly through training and evaluations, the process may be completed in 4 to six months. Nevertheless, many individuals take 8 months to a year or longer, particularly if they have busy schedules or require additional practice time. The compulsory waiting durations between specific components of the training also affect the general timeline.

Is it possible to take the driving test in English?

Yes, both the theoretical examination and the useful driving test can be taken in a number of languages, including English. Prospects ought to validate the accessibility of their favored language when scheduling assessments. Some driving schools likewise use direction in English, though this may come at an additional cost compared to guideline offered in Swedish.

What occurs if I fail an examination?

Failure on a theoretical or practical examination does temporarily disqualify prospects. Individuals may retake the assessment after paying the appropriate cost and finishing any recommended extra training. Can I begin the procedure while still under 18 years of age?

While individuals can not receive an actual license up until they turn 18 for Category B, they can begin the training process earlier. Numerous aspiring motorists start their theoretical education and even some useful training at 17 years of age. This early start permits prospects to be totally prepared to take the useful test instantly upon reaching the minimum age requirement.
